Week 13: Introduction to Spreadsheets

Homework for the Teacher

  • As you know, measurement is an area that tends to give fifth graders some trouble on the End of Grade Test. For that reason, you will have the opportunity to spend the next five weeks working with students on the use of spreadsheets for understanding, using, and converting standard units of metric and customary measurement. The emphasis is not on learning spreadsheet software; it is on using spreadsheet software as a tool to collect and analyze data, explore "what if" statements, learn content and much more. In the process, students will learn basic spreadsheet terminology while using the tool to perform calculations, observe results, and display data graphically.

Reading Strategy Spotlight
Question! Have students ask questions of themselves, questions of the authors, and questions regarding the validity of text. Questioning is fundamental to being alive. Questions help children formulate beliefs. What questions do they have before they start to read? What questions rise to the surface while they are reading? What questions would they like to ask the author? What questions will go unanswered?
